Minggu, 22 Juli 2012

A Glimpse of JavaFX


JavaFX is a Java technology that is intended to build or design applications with rich multimedia content such as graphics; Sound; Effect Graphics, and Video; were integrated into the WEB Site to the Internet or intranet.
JavaFX is often called RIAs (Rich Internet Applications), application examples RIAs are: framework; Curl; GWT; Adobe Flash / Adobe Flex / AIR, Java / JavaFX; Mozilla XUL, and Microsoft Silverlight. RIAs are applications of semantic Web (Semantic Web Application) which is largely derived from the characteristics of desktop applications, in other words we can bring to the desktop environment in a Web browser, for example, on the desktop we can see from our photo collection of thumbnails, play music, watch videos, and much more; so also allows running in a web browser. Desktop applications can be delivered in a standard web-browser-based or independently via sandboxes or virtual machine, and this is the advantage possessed by JavaFX and JavaFX as well as a differentiator with Java technology previously owned by such JSE (Java Standard Edition), JEE (Java Enterprise Edition), JME (Java Micro Edition) and has the disadvantage that requires a lot of resources or applications High End.
JavaFX Developer introduced directly by the head of Sun Microsystems, James Gosling. By James Gosling project was launched to provide a higher level of security and well that is not owned by yourself using AJAX because AJAX Javascript that was not designed with security and privacy are high and good. James Gosling believes in addition to a high level of security and well, and is also coupled with the ease of designing a program and more declarative, JavaFX able to compete with AJAX is considered too complex to be done by a non-programmer.
When programming AJAX Developer requires a skill to master coding techniques, one thing that is not owned by the makers website, and is an obstacle for them in expressing their website demanded more expressive and dynamic. Sun believes that JavaFX can overcome this problem and target JavaFX and JavaFX Script to be didaya use by Developers who are not programmers.
JavaFX promising web creations that can be run on a computer, digital TV, regular TV and portable devices, and will look the same on all platforms.
JavaFX is very significant developments in the booming since in the year 2009, and has several advantages including:
1. Fully cross platform.
  Although officially solaris and linux versions have not been released, but has been able to run JavaFX
  in the neighborhood unix-based.
2. Integrating graphics with the help of tools from 3rd parties.
  JavaFX includes a set of plugins with Adobe Illustrator and Photoshop that allows to
  integrated directly into JavaFX applications.
3. Draggable applet / Drag to Install
  Maybe this is one of the most revolutionary of the JDK-update-N is, the applet
  fact of life in our browser, we can now pull out of the browser, and can still be
  active.

 
 
 
                                                        Advantage of using javafx


Why should wear JavaFX?
Because Java is the parent of the JavaFX can run on all sorts of devices, and its presence can be integrated with RIA technology as described above. As in the manufacture of desktop applications, Web, and Mobile as well as the Digital TV. Besides JavaFX is also designed to optimize the view supported by JavaSwing, Java 2D and Java3D for Developers and Research. JavaFX structure is also very suitable for display to the GUI, making it easier to read and corrected.
Later there will be an easy to use visual designers to build applications or web-based applications for mobile JavaFX including using JavaFX mobile products.
Unlike its predecessor, JavaFX technology using its own programming language called JavaFX Script. And the file extension *. Fx.

Tidak ada komentar:

Posting Komentar